## Step 4: Swap the scanner adapter

Heads up, reviewer: this is where we rip out the old Lintrex driver and point checkout at the new Beamcatch SDK. The ScanBridge service now owns all symbology parsing, so the kiosk code just forwards raw frames. Double-check the retry wrapper in `scan_client.py` — it's easy to miss. Once the adapter compiles, ScanBridge needs its environment block set before first boot. Apply the following configuration values exactly as shown below.

deployment values, fafog-fawip:
[jorox]
team = fendor
access_code = ac_bb00ea
host = jorox.qorveltech.internal
port = 9200
owner = istdor.aldeth
peer = julvan.orvexlabs.internal

## Timing-Chip Reader: First Response

When a Striderline chip reader at a mat goes dark, do not restart it immediately — it buffers reads locally for up to ten minutes. First confirm whether the uplink light is amber (network loss) or off (power loss). For network loss, reseat the field cable at the junction box; for power loss, swap in the spare battery pack from the timing van. Record the reader's mat position and the gap window in the incident sheet. The full recovery checklist for new crew members lives on the internal page here:

operations page: https://jenkins.zemvarcloud.local/job/merge_requests/repo/build/73930b4b30f0a8ed

Internal Memo — Finance Team, Brenlow Instruments

The Brenlow Authorized Reseller Programme launches next quarter. Finance should prepare margin schedules for the two partner tiers and update revenue-recognition treatment for channel sales. Rebate accruals will be tracked monthly. Initial onboarding covers twelve partners in the Velmont territory. Budget impact is modest in year one. Related planning details are set out in the confidential note below.

board note of taweg-fahof: Eliiusax Group plans to raise the Ralwyn list price by 60 percent in August.

Load testing notes for the Bramblecart checkout flow, for this week's sync. Use the Stonepress harness against staging only. Target: 400 orders/min sustained, 15 min. Watch the payment-stub latency panel; abort if p99 exceeds 2s. The harness authenticates to the staging gateway before each run, so its .env needs the credential set on the following line.

vault entry, yahif-yajep: COURIER_KEY29=b802bdf8034096b65a51c6ba5abe2